Beyond bone health, vitamin D exerts hepatoprotective effects through immunomodulatory and anti-inflammatory mechanisms, suppressing mediators such as IL-4, IL-6, TNF-, and toll-like receptors, which lowers the risk of liver inflammation, cirrhosis, hepatocellular carcinoma, and hepatitis B [75]
